2026WCQ: Papa Daniel Mustapha surprised by Super Eagles call up

Niger Tornadoes midfielder Papa Daniel Mustapha said he was shocked when he learned he was called up to the Super Eagles squad for the very first time, Afrosport reports. The 23-year-old was among four players who received their maiden call ups to the national team by new coach Eric Chelle for the 2026 FIFA World Cup Qualifiers against Rwanda and Zimbabwe. Nigeria’s Eniola Bolaji wins gold at Spanish Para-Badminton International

Nigeria’s para-badminton star, Mariam Eniola Bolaji on Sunday won gold at the 2025 Spanish Para-Badminton International in Vitoria, Spain, defeating Ukraine's world No. 4 Oksana Kozyna 2-0 (21-15, 21-15) in straight sets, Afrosport reports. The multiple African champion displayed sheer dominance all through the tournament, overcoming opponents from Brazil, France, Austrailia and India.
